执行程序段:
int x=6;
do {
if(x%3) {cout<<'#'; continue;}
} while(x--);
int x=6;
do {
if(x%3) {cout<<'#'; continue;}
} while(x--);
举一反三
- 中国大学MOOC: 下面程序段:x=3; do{y=x--;if(!y) {cout<<”x”; continue;}cout<<”#”;}while(x>=1 && x<=2);
- 程序段“int x=2; do{cout<<x--;}while(!x);”中循环体的执行次数是( )。 A: 3 B: 2 C: 1 D: 死循环
- 若有如下语句 int x=3; do { x=x-2; printf("%d ",x); x--;}while(!x); 则上面程序段.
- 下面程序段的输出结果是( ). x=3; do { y=x--; if (!y) {printf("*");continue;} printf("#"); } while(x=2);
- 有如下程序段,其中语句 x--; 执行的次数是( )。 int x = 10; while ( x = 0 ) x--;